R730
Indoor 802.11ax 8x8:8 Wi-Fi Access Point
with Multi-gigabit backhaul

DATA SHEET
BENEFITS
CONNECT MORE DEVICES SIMULTANEOUSLY Improve device performance, by enabling more simultaneous device connections with built-in 12 spatial streams (8x8:8 in 5GHz, 4x4:4 in 2.4GHz), MU-MIMO and OFDMA technology.
ULTRA-HIGH-DENSITY PERFORMANCE Provides exceptional end-user experience within stadiums, large public venues, convention centers and school auditoriums with the Ruckus Ultra-High-Density Technology Suite.
ENHANCED SECURITY Upgrade to the latest Wi-Fi security standard with WPA3 and receive enhanced protection from man-in-the-middle attacks in the most secure way.
MULTI-GIGABIT ACCESS SPEEDS Optimized multi-gigabit Wi-Fi performance delivered using built-in 5GbE/2.5GbE Ethernet ports to connect to multi-gigabit switches.
DEVICE MANAGEMENT OPTIONS Manage the R730 with on premise physical/ virtual appliances and control autoprovisioning for faster deployment and seamless firmware upgrades.
BETTER MESH NETWORKING Minimize complexity by reducing expensive cabling with SmartMeshTM that dynamically creates self-forming, self-healing mesh networks.
AUTOMATE OPTIMAL THROUGHPUT ChannelFlyTM dynamic channel technology uses machine learning to automatically find the least congested channels. You always get the highest throughput the band can support.
MORE THAN WI-FI Support services beyond Wi-Fi with Ruckus IoT Suite, Cloudpath security and onboarding software, SPoT Wi-Fi locationing engine, and SCI network analytics.

The R730 is based on the latest Wi-Fi standard, 802.11ax and bridges the performance gap from `gigabit' Wi-Fi to `multigigabit' Wi-Fi in support of the insatiable demand for better and faster Wi-Fi.
The Ruckus R730 is our highest capacity dual-band, dual-concurrent 802.11ax AP that supports 12 spatial streams (8x8:8 in 5GHz, 4x4:4 in 2.4GHz). The R730, with OFDMA and MU-MIMO capabilities, efficiently manages more than 1K client connections with increased capacity, improved coverage and performance in ultrahigh dense environments. Furthermore, 5 Gbps multi-gigabit Ethernet ports enhances backhaul capacity.
Additionally, the R730 is IoT- and LTE-ready, and supports wireless standards beyond Wi-Fi in combination with the Ruckus IoT Suite and our CBRS/OpenG modules.
The R730 addresses the increasing client demands in transit hubs, auditoriums, stadiums, conference centers, and other highly trafficked indoor spaces. It is the perfect choice for data-intensive streaming multimedia applications like 4K video transmissions, while supporting latency sensitive voice and data applications with stringent quality-of-service requirements.
The R730 when paired with the Ruckus Ultra-High density Technology Suite found only in the Ruckus Wi-Fi portfolio, dramatically improves network performance through a combination of patented wireless innovations and learning algorithms that includes:
� Airtime Decongestion: Increases average network throughput in heavily congested environments
� Transient Client management: Reduces interference traffic from unconnected Wi-Fi devices
� BeamFlex+ Antennas: Extended coverage and optimized throughput with patented multi-directional antennas and radio patterns
Whether you're deploying ten or ten thousand APs, the R730 is also easy to manage through Ruckus' appliance and virtual management options.

ACCESS POINT ANTENNA PATTERN
Ruckus' BeamFlex+ adaptive antennas allow the R730 AP to dynamically choose among a host of antenna patterns (over 4,000 possible combinations) in real-time to establish the best possible connection with every device. This leads to:
� Better Wi-Fi coverage
� Reduced RF interference
Traditional omni-directional antennas, found in generic access points, oversaturate the environment by needlessly radiating RF signals in all directions. In contrast, the Ruckus BeamFlex+ adaptive antenna directs the radio signals perdevice on a packet by-packet basis to optimize Wi-Fi coverage and capacity in realtime to support high device density environments. BeamFlex+ operates without the need for device feedback and hence can benefit even devices using legacy standards.

PERFORMANCE AND CAPACITY

Peak PHY Rates

� 2.4GHz: 1.148 Gbps (11ax) � 5GHz: 4.8 Gbps (11ax)

Client Capacity

� Up to 1024 clients per AP

Simultaneous VoIP Clients

� Up to 60 per AP

SSID

� Up to 16 per radio
